Abstract We investigate the expressiveness of backward jumps in a framework of formalized sequential programming called program algebra. We show that - if expressiveness is measured in terms of the computability of partial Boolean functions - then backward jumps are superfluous. If we, however, want to prevent explosion of the length of programs, then backward jumps are essential.
